This post includes recipes for ground venison … WebMay 12, 2016 · The key to any good venison is preparation. You must remove all the fat. The fat in venison is what gives it that undesirable flavor. Canning enhances the flavors, so even a little bit of fat will spoil the taste. Trim all the fat and as much connective tissue and silver skin as you can. The goal is to have just lean red muscle meat. Web1. Butcher the Meat. The first step in the process is to prepare the meat.
